What Are the Backstories of Key MHA Girls?
Understanding the backstories of the MHA girls provides insight into their motivations and the challenges they face.
Name | Quirk | Backstory | Personality Traits |
---|---|---|---|
Ochaco Uraraka | Zero Gravity | She comes from a humble background and aspires to become a hero to support her family. | Optimistic, determined, and caring. |
Tsuyu Asui | Frog | Her upbringing in a family of heroes inspired her to join U.A. High School. | Practical, observant, and loyal. |
Yayoirozu Momo | Creation | Born into a wealthy family, she struggles with self-worth and the pressure to succeed. | Intelligent, resourceful, and serious. |
Himiko Toga | Transformation | Her fascination with blood leads her down a darker path, becoming an antagonist. | Playful, unpredictable, and passionate. |
